WordPress vs Next.js: The Ultimate 2024 Comparison for Web Development

Iulian Dragomirescu

Iulian Dragomirescu

· 3 minute de citit
WordPress vs Next.js: The Ultimate 2024 Comparison for Web Development

Introduction

In the ever-evolving landscape of web development, choosing the right platform is crucial for success. As we step into 2024, WordPress and Next.js remain two of the most popular options for developers. This article provides an in-depth comparison of WordPress vs. Next.js, examining their features, performance, SEO capabilities, ease of use, and more. Whether you're a seasoned developer or a business owner looking to build a new website, this guide will help you make an informed decision.

What is WordPress?

WordPress is a powerful content management system (CMS) that has dominated the web development space for over a decade. It offers a user-friendly interface, extensive plugin ecosystem, and flexible theming capabilities. WordPress powers over 40% of all websites on the internet, making it a go-to choice for bloggers, small businesses, and even large enterprises.

Key Features of WordPress:

  • Ease of Use: Intuitive dashboard and WYSIWYG editor.
  • Plugins and Themes: Thousands of plugins and themes available for customization.
  • SEO-Friendly: Built-in SEO tools and plugins like Yoast SEO.
  • Community Support: Extensive documentation and a large community for support.

What is Next.js?

Next.js is a React-based framework that enables developers to build fast, scalable, and SEO-friendly web applications. It offers server-side rendering (SSR), static site generation (SSG), and hybrid capabilities, making it a versatile choice for modern web development. Next.js is particularly favored by developers who want to leverage the power of React for building dynamic web applications.

Key Features of Next.js:

  • Performance: Optimized for speed with SSR and SSG.
  • SEO Capabilities: Better control over SEO with server-side rendering.
  • Flexibility: Supports a wide range of use cases from static sites to complex applications.
  • Developer Experience: Enhanced development experience with hot reloading, built-in CSS support, and more.

Performance Comparison

Performance is a critical factor in web development, affecting both user experience and SEO rankings.

WordPress Performance:

  • WordPress relies heavily on plugins, which can impact loading times if not optimized.
  • Caching plugins and Content Delivery Networks (CDNs) can improve performance.
  • Managed WordPress hosting providers offer optimized environments for better speed.

Next.js Performance:

  • Next.js excels in performance with built-in SSR and SSG, reducing initial load times.
  • Code splitting and lazy loading further enhance performance.
  • Deployments on platforms like Vercel can optimize performance with edge caching.

SEO Capabilities

SEO is a vital consideration for any website, influencing its visibility and traffic.

WordPress SEO:

  • WordPress offers robust SEO capabilities with plugins like Yoast SEO and All in One SEO Pack.
  • Easy integration of SEO best practices like meta tags, sitemaps, and schema markup.
  • Content-focused approach can help in creating SEO-friendly content.

Next.js SEO:

  • Next.js provides excellent SEO with server-side rendering, ensuring search engines can easily index pages.
  • Fine-grained control over meta tags and structured data.
  • Performance optimizations contribute to better SEO rankings.

Ease of Use

User-friendliness can significantly impact the development process and maintenance.

WordPress Ease of Use:

  • Ideal for non-developers with its intuitive interface.
  • Extensive documentation and tutorials for beginners.
  • Drag-and-drop builders like Elementor simplify design.

Next.js Ease of Use:

  • Requires a good understanding of React and JavaScript.
  • Best suited for developers comfortable with coding.
  • Comprehensive documentation and a growing community support.

Flexibility and Customization

Both platforms offer flexibility but cater to different needs.

WordPress Flexibility:

  • Wide range of themes and plugins for customization.
  • Suitable for various types of websites from blogs to e-commerce.
  • Custom post types and taxonomies for complex content structures.

Next.js Flexibility:

  • High degree of customization for bespoke applications.
  • Supports headless CMS integrations for dynamic content management.
  • Ideal for complex web applications requiring custom solutions.

Conclusion

Choosing between WordPress and Next.js in 2024 depends on your specific needs and expertise. WordPress is an excellent choice for users seeking an easy-to-use, content-focused platform with a wealth of plugins and themes. Next.js is ideal for developers looking to build high-performance, SEO-friendly web applications with the power of React.

Evaluate your project requirements, consider your technical skills, and weigh the pros and cons of each platform to make the best decision for your web development journey in 2024.

Keywords:

  • WordPress vs Next.js 2024
  • WordPress features 2024
  • Next.js features 2024
  • WordPress SEO 2024
  • Next.js SEO 2024
  • Web development platforms 2024
  • WordPress performance 2024
  • Next.js performance 2024

Additional SEO Tips:

  • Use internal and external links within the article to enhance credibility and user experience.
  • Include relevant images and optimize their alt texts for SEO.
  • Share the article on social media platforms and relevant forums to increase visibility and backlinks.
  • Keep the content updated with the latest trends and changes in WordPress and Next.js.
Iulian Dragomirescu

Despre Iulian Dragomirescu

Salut, sunt Iulian, fondatorul DevCodes. Îmi place să scriu cod, atât pe front-end, cât și pe back-end, dezvoltând soluții complete și inovative pentru clienți.

Copyright © 2024 . All rights reserved.
Created by DevCodes·Full Stack Web Development
devcodes logo Creare Site ↗